On Tue, 2007-05-15 at 07:46 -0700, Tom Spec wrote:
> Is it possible for me to install Fedora without DVD/CD, USB Key,
> Floppy or PXE server if I already have an existing (older) Fedora
> installation running?  
> 
> Specifically, can I download the ISOs to my HD, then somehow get grub
> to throw me into the first ISO when I boot my machine, so that I can
> then start a new installation?
> 

I've not heard of being able to boot off of an image on a hard disk.
You may be able to make a filesystem containing bootable contents that
will work though. Should be able to anyway. You could possibly make a
filesystem containing the boot.iso contents and go from there.
